site stats

Edge weighted digraph java

WebNov 27, 2024 · * To iterate over the edges in this edge-weighted digraph, use foreach notation: * {@code for (DirectedEdge e : G.edges())}. * * @return all edges in this edge … Webpackage graphs; /***** * Compilation: javac EdgeWeightedDigraph.java * Execution: java EdgeWeightedDigraph V E * Dependencies: Bag.java DirectedEdge.java * * An edge-weighted digraph, implemented using adjacency lists.

2. A* For Euclidean Graphs: This question is based on - Chegg

WebJava EdgeWeightedDigraph.addEdge - 6 examples found. These are the top rated real world Java examples of EdgeWeightedDigraph.addEdge extracted from open source … WebApr 16, 2024 · We introduce and analyze Dijkstra's algorithm for shortest-paths problems with nonnegative weights. Next, we consider an even faster algorithm for DAGs, which works even if the weights are negative. We conclude with the Bellman−Ford−Moore algorithm for edge-weighted digraphs with no negative cycles. bookbinding cloth hobby lobby https://taffinc.org

Directed graph implementation in Java - Stack Overflow

WebCreate client programmes that utilise your edge-weighted digraph to generate edge-weighted digraphs for a wide range of V and E values that have a significant portion of negative weights but only a few negative cycles. Q3a. Given that an old farmhouse is visible on the ground and the map, recommend a way to determine the scale of the hardcopy ... WebGraph.getEdgeWeight How to use getEdgeWeight method in org.jgrapht.Graph Best Java code snippets using org.jgrapht. Graph.getEdgeWeight (Showing top 20 results out of 315) org.jgrapht Graph getEdgeWeight WebE - the graph edge type All Implemented Interfaces: java.io.Serializable, java.lang.Cloneable, ... The default implementation of an undirected weighted graph. A default undirected weighted graph is a non-simple undirected graph in which multiple (parallel) edges between any two vertices are not permitted, but loops are. The edges of … book binding business philippines

EdgeWeightedDigraph (Algorithms 4/e) - Princeton University

Category:algs4/EdgeWeightedDigraph.java at master · kevin …

Tags:Edge weighted digraph java

Edge weighted digraph java

algs4/EdgeWeightedDigraph.java at master · kevin-wayne/algs4

WebJul 29, 2024 · ‘ Edge-Weighted ‘ means that the graph will have edges (or connections) that have a weight (or cost), ‘ Digraph ‘ means that the graph will be a directed graph – the edges will point only one way. Airports Let’s implement this graph on a fun example. WebJava EdgeWeightedDigraph - 25 examples found. These are the top rated real world Java examples of EdgeWeightedDigraph extracted from open source projects. You can rate examples to help us improve the quality of examples. Programming Language: Java Class/Type: EdgeWeightedDigraph Examples at hotexamples.com: 25 Frequently Used …

Edge weighted digraph java

Did you know?

WebQuestion: For this assignment, you will use the edge weighted digraph code (using adjacency lists) included with the assignment file to add more functions. The following functions are what you need to add to the WeightedDigraph.java file: 1- Implement a copy constructor in the WeightedDigraph to create a deep copy of a weighted digraph object. WebJava; Data Structures; Cornerstones; Calculus; Directed and Edge-Weighted Graphs Directed Graphs (i.e., Digraphs) In some cases, one finds it natural to associate each …

WebHow to implement Edge Weighted Directed Graph in Java (Graphs, Part 4) Mehul Parmar 47 subscribers Subscribe 1.9K views 2 years ago This is a continuation of my earlier video • How to... WebHow to implement Edge Weighted Directed Graph in Java (Graphs, Part 4) Mehul Parmar 47 subscribers Subscribe 1.9K views 2 years ago This is a continuation of my earlier …

WebNov 16, 2024 · EdgeWeightedDigraph.java implements the API using the adjacency-lists representation. Shortest paths API. We use the following API for computing the shortest paths of an edge-weighted digraph: We … WebMar 21, 2024 · A graph is a pair (V, E), where V is a set of nodes, called vertices and E is a collection of pairs of vertices, called edges. A weighted graph is a graph in which a weight is assigned to each edge to represent distance or costs. A graph with no cycles is called a tree. A tree is an acyclic connected graph. Applications of Graphs

Web"""A weighted digraph represented as a matrix.""" ... the diagonal of the matrix should have all Os. For each edge in the edge list, with corresponding weight from the weights list, you should have the weight in 2 positions in the matrix (remember for an undirected graph, the matrix is symmetric). ... (i.e., self._W). Although in Java, you can ...

WebJava Coding. AStar. package pa2; import edu.princeton.cs.algs4.*; ... * other vertex in the edge-weighted graph {@code G}. * * @param G the edge-weighted digraph * @param s the source vertex, t is target * @throws IllegalArgumentException if an edge weight is … godmother 5 gameWebSep 29, 2016 · A graph is made out of nodes and directed edges which define a connection from one node to another node. A node (or vertex) is a discrete position in a graph. … book binding business planWebJava EdgeWeightedDigraph - 25 examples found. These are the top rated real world Java examples of EdgeWeightedDigraph extracted from open source projects. You can rate … bookbinding courses near meWebConstructs an empty edge-weighted digraph with V vertices and 0 edges. EdgeWeightedDiGraph (stdlib.In in) Constructs an edge-weighted digraph from the … godmother alex and ani amazonWeb/***** * Compilation: javac EdgeWeightedDigraph.java * Execution: java EdgeWeightedDigraph V E * Dependencies: Bag.java DirectedEdge.java * * An edge-weighted digraph ... book binding course onlinehttp://algs4.cs.princeton.edu/44sp/EdgeWeightedDigraph.java.html godmother agencyWebDec 9, 2024 · Just off the top, I thought that having a Linked List kind class with a value field and an array of link (self referential) fields like the code below: public class Digraph { T vertex; Digraph [] edge; public Digraph (T val, int maxDegree) { vertex = val; edge = new Digraph [maxDegree]; } } book binding cincinnati ohio